基本信息
文件名称:提高Web开发效率的方法试题及答案.docx
文件大小:15.4 KB
总页数:12 页
更新时间:2025-05-30
总字数:约4.77千字
文档摘要

提高Web开发效率的方法试题及答案

姓名:____________________

一、单项选择题(每题2分,共10题)

1.以下哪个不是提高Web开发效率的方法?

A.使用预处理器如Sass或Less

B.依赖JavaScript框架如React或Vue

C.使用传统的HTML表格布局

D.使用模块化JavaScript

2.在Web开发中,哪项技术可以提高代码的重用性?

A.CSS

B.JavaScript

C.HTML

D.AJAX

3.以下哪个不是提高Web开发性能的方法?

A.使用压缩版本的库文件

B.减少HTTP请求

C.使用GIF格式替换JPEG

D.使用懒加载技术

4.以下哪个不是Web前端开发中的预处理器?

A.Sass

B.JavaScript

C.Less

D.CoffeeScript

5.在Web开发中,以下哪个技术可以提高用户体验?

A.响应式设计

B.使用大量的JavaScript动画效果

C.不进行页面优化

D.使用大量的图片

6.以下哪个不是Web开发中的构建工具?

A.Webpack

B.Gulp

C.Node.js

D.jQuery

7.在Web开发中,以下哪个技术可以提高代码的可维护性?

A.使用全局变量

B.使用函数封装

C.使用过多的内联样式

D.使用过多的全局事件处理

8.以下哪个不是Web开发中的跨浏览器兼容性解决方案?

A.使用Babel转换ES6+代码

B.使用Polyfill填充浏览器功能

C.使用CSS前缀

D.使用JavaScript库

9.在Web开发中,以下哪个技术可以提高代码的加载速度?

A.使用CDN加速资源加载

B.使用过多的内联样式

C.使用大量的JavaScript动画效果

D.使用过多的图片

10.以下哪个不是Web开发中的版本控制工具?

A.Git

B.SVN

C.Docker

D.MySQL

二、填空题(每题2分,共5题)

1.Web开发中,预处理器可以用来提高___________。

2.在Web开发中,使用___________技术可以减少HTTP请求,提高页面加载速度。

3.Web开发中,响应式设计可以适应___________。

4.Web开发中,使用___________可以提高代码的重用性。

5.Web开发中,版本控制工具可以用来___________。

三、简答题(每题5分,共10分)

1.简述提高Web开发效率的方法。

2.简述响应式设计在Web开发中的重要性。

四、编程题(每题10分,共20分)

1.使用Sass编写一个简单的样式表,包括字体、颜色和边距。

2.使用JavaScript编写一个简单的计算器,实现加、减、乘、除运算。

二、多项选择题(每题3分,共10题)

1.在Web开发中,以下哪些是提高代码可维护性的最佳实践?

A.使用清晰的命名规范

B.避免全局变量

C.使用CSS预处理器

D.频繁地重构代码

E.在代码中添加大量注释

2.以下哪些方法可以优化Web应用的加载时间?

A.使用压缩版本的JavaScript库

B.利用浏览器缓存

C.使用CSSSprites

D.减少HTTP请求的数量

E.使用Web字体

3.在Web开发中,以下哪些是提高用户体验的关键因素?

A.网站的可访问性

B.网站的响应速度

C.网站的视觉设计

D.网站的交互性

E.网站的SEO优化

4.以下哪些是常用的Web前端框架?

A.AngularJS

B.Backbone.js

C.React

D.Vue.js

E.jQuery

5.在Web开发中,以下哪些是提高代码安全性的措施?

A.对用户输入进行验证

B.使用HTTPS加密通信

C.避免使用eval函数

D.使用安全的密码策略

E.定期更新依赖库

6.以下哪些是Web开发中常用的预处理器?

A.Sass

B.Less

C.Stylus

D.CoffeeScript

E.TypeScript

7.在Web开发中,以下哪些是提高网站性能的方法?

A.使用CDN分发内容

B.实施图片懒加载

C.使用WebWorkers处理后台任务

D.避免使用外部JavaScript库

E.使用CSSFlexbox布局

8.以下哪些是Web开发中常用的版本控制工具?

A.Git

B.Subversion(SVN)

C.Mercurial

D.Perforce

E.TeamFoundationServer(TFS)

9.在Web开发中,以下哪些是提高网站SEO的方法?

A.使用语义化HTML